Output fb70b59b656a6a1e888f75527f0b4252e7d5917c50e1d471c923b49f4bb0c01a:0

value
3107254427
script pubkey
OP_0 OP_PUSHBYTES_20 f2d590453f60238b071e25c7fb7ed7672a698bba
address
tb1q7t2eq3flvq3ckpc7yhrlklkhvu4xnza6frrq0n
transaction
fb70b59b656a6a1e888f75527f0b4252e7d5917c50e1d471c923b49f4bb0c01a